Appetites: Legislators announce bipartisan effort to fight child hunger

Minnesota Republican and DFL legislators have come together to announce the formation of a new Child Hunger Caucus. This bipartisan effort will team up with businesses and non-profits to try to reduce food insecurity for kids in Minnesota.

Representatives Erin Maye Quade, DFL-Apple Valley, and Tony Jurgens, R-Cottage Grove, joined Tom Crann this week to talk about why this issue crosses party lines and what they hope to accomplish.
